Nothing wrong, as others have said, with having more than one system. This is quite common, actually, because each system has certain advantages to offer. I understand your post. You give the very understandable reasons for your getting into your Fuji gear. Especially that your choice has been for business purposes. Then you express you've been missing the K-1 you've given up, reveal that you still have some other Pentax gear, including a K-3, and are wondering what has been going on with Pentax. I don't see anything here other than a compliment to Pentax.

I have known of numerous photographers over the years who bought a camera body of a different system than their main one, simply because of a particular special lens they wanted to use! I've had really no need for getting a K-1 because I'm getting very satisfying results with the APS-C equipment I have. But I also have some outstanding FF lenses I've long been using for 35mm film, which goad me towards getting a FF body.

In your case, you already have a K-3, an excellent body. I certainly understand why you keep it. Perhaps now the DA* 11-18mm f/2.8 intrigues you. I can understand that also. It is an outstanding lens. For a far less expensive option, however, I recently acquired a Sigma 10-20mm f/3.5 EX DC which I've been using on my KP. The reduced price from B&H was irresistible. I have been pleasantly surprised at its fine performance, as well as its very good build quality and design. Not quite the magnitude of speed and construction of the Pentax DA* 11-18mm, but it has its own advantages. Either one is better for my needs than carrying a DFA 15-30mm f/2.8 on a K-1 body, at a fraction of the size, weight, and cost!

I truly believe the new APS-C Pentax flagship body will eventually appear, and it will prove to be a definite step forward and worth the wait.
